CSC 99W is a 2009 Honda Cr-v in Silver with a 2,204c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.

Across all 2009 Honda Cr-v models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.4% with a typical mileage of 85,542 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Honda Cr-v f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 62,925 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CSC 99W,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Cr-v typ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 17 years old, this Honda Cr-v is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
